Checking In
Emotional intelligence doesn’t grow in dramatic moments — it grows in small, intentional choices repeated every day. Today, I want to invite you to do one simple practice that can profoundly strengthen your emotional awareness: ✨ The One-Minute Pause At least once today — right when you feel a reaction rising — take 60 seconds to pause. During that pause: - Notice what emotion is showing up - Put a name to it (even if it’s imperfect) - Take one slow breath in… and one slow breath out - Then choose a response instead of reacting That’s it. One minute. But here’s the truth: This tiny practice rewires emotional patterns, sharpens self-awareness, and quietly builds the emotional strength we all want. Little things become big things. Small choices become strong habits. Daily pauses become emotional power. I’m proud of the work you’re doing — not because it’s perfect, but because it’s intentional.
